Western Australia PD Titan helped police find methamphetamine, cannabis and cash when he was visiting Dongara last week.

Dongara Police said with help from Three Springs, Carnamah and Geraldton Police, they executed search warrants on a number of properties last Friday about 10am (March 10).

Police said with PD Titan’s help they about one gram of methamphetamine along with cannabis, three cannabis plants and cash on properties in Port Dennison and Dongara.

Smoking implements and dried cannabis was also found.

Police said they are still speaking with persons of interest and no charges have been laid.
